52 /*
53  * List of workarounds for devices that required behavior not specified in
54  * the standard.
55  */
56 enum nvme_quirks {
57 	/*
58 	 * Prefers I/O aligned to a stripe size specified in a vendor
59 	 * specific Identify field.
60 	 */
61 	NVME_QUIRK_STRIPE_SIZE			= (1 << 0),
62 
63 	/*
64 	 * The controller doesn't handle Identify value others than 0 or 1
65 	 * correctly.
66 	 */
67 	NVME_QUIRK_IDENTIFY_CNS			= (1 << 1),
68 
69 	/*
70 	 * The controller deterministically returns O's on reads to
71 	 * logical blocks that deallocate was called on.
72 	 */
73 	NVME_QUIRK_DEALLOCATE_ZEROES		= (1 << 2),
74 
75 	/*
76 	 * The controller needs a delay before starts checking the device
77 	 * readiness, which is done by reading the NVME_CSTS_RDY bit.
78 	 */
79 	NVME_QUIRK_DELAY_BEFORE_CHK_RDY		= (1 << 3),
80 
81 	/*
82 	 * APST should not be used.
83 	 */
84 	NVME_QUIRK_NO_APST			= (1 << 4),
85 
86 	/*
87 	 * The deepest sleep state should not be used.
88 	 */
89 	NVME_QUIRK_NO_DEEPEST_PS		= (1 << 5),
90 
91 	/*
92 	 * Set MEDIUM priority on SQ creation
93 	 */
94 	NVME_QUIRK_MEDIUM_PRIO_SQ		= (1 << 7),
95 
96 	/*
97 	 * Ignore device provided subnqn.
98 	 */
99 	NVME_QUIRK_IGNORE_DEV_SUBNQN		= (1 << 8),
100 
101 	/*
102 	 * Broken Write Zeroes.
103 	 */
104 	NVME_QUIRK_DISABLE_WRITE_ZEROES		= (1 << 9),
105 
106 	/*
107 	 * Force simple suspend/resume path.
108 	 */
109 	NVME_QUIRK_SIMPLE_SUSPEND		= (1 << 10),
110 
111 	/*
112 	 * Use only one interrupt vector for all queues
113 	 */
114 	NVME_QUIRK_SINGLE_VECTOR		= (1 << 11),
115 
116 	/*
117 	 * Use non-standard 128 bytes SQEs.
118 	 */
119 	NVME_QUIRK_128_BYTES_SQES		= (1 << 12),
120 
121 	/*
122 	 * Prevent tag overlap between queues
123 	 */
124 	NVME_QUIRK_SHARED_TAGS                  = (1 << 13),
125 
126 	/*
127 	 * Don't change the value of the temperature threshold feature
128 	 */
129 	NVME_QUIRK_NO_TEMP_THRESH_CHANGE	= (1 << 14),
130 
131 	/*
132 	 * The controller doesn't handle the Identify Namespace
133 	 * Identification Descriptor list subcommand despite claiming
134 	 * NVMe 1.3 compliance.
135 	 */
136 	NVME_QUIRK_NO_NS_DESC_LIST		= (1 << 15),
137 
138 	/*
139 	 * The controller does not properly handle DMA addresses over
140 	 * 48 bits.
141 	 */
142 	NVME_QUIRK_DMA_ADDRESS_BITS_48		= (1 << 16),
143 
144 	/*
145 	 * The controller requires the command_id value be limited, so skip
146 	 * encoding the generation sequence number.
147 	 */
148 	NVME_QUIRK_SKIP_CID_GEN			= (1 << 17),
149 
150 	/*
151 	 * Reports garbage in the namespace identifiers (eui64, nguid, uuid).
152 	 */
153 	NVME_QUIRK_BOGUS_NID			= (1 << 18),
154 
155 	/*
156 	 * No temperature thresholds for channels other than 0 (Composite).
157 	 */
158 	NVME_QUIRK_NO_SECONDARY_TEMP_THRESH	= (1 << 19),
159 
160 	/*
161 	 * Disables simple suspend/resume path.
162 	 */
163 	NVME_QUIRK_FORCE_NO_SIMPLE_SUSPEND	= (1 << 20),
164 
165 	/*
166 	 * MSI (but not MSI-X) interrupts are broken and never fire.
167 	 */
168 	NVME_QUIRK_BROKEN_MSI			= (1 << 21),
169 };

219 /*
220  * enum nvme_ctrl_state: Controller state
221  *
222  * @NVME_CTRL_NEW:		New controller just allocated, initial state
223  * @NVME_CTRL_LIVE:		Controller is connected and I/O capable
224  * @NVME_CTRL_RESETTING:	Controller is resetting (or scheduled reset)
225  * @NVME_CTRL_CONNECTING:	Controller is disconnected, now connecting the
226  *				transport
227  * @NVME_CTRL_DELETING:		Controller is deleting (or scheduled deletion)
228  * @NVME_CTRL_DELETING_NOIO:	Controller is deleting and I/O is not
229  *				disabled/failed immediately. This state comes
230  * 				after all async event processing took place and
231  * 				before ns removal and the controller deletion
232  * 				progress
233  * @NVME_CTRL_DEAD:		Controller is non-present/unresponsive during
234  *				shutdown or removal. In this case we forcibly
235  *				kill all inflight I/O as they have no chance to
236  *				complete
237  */
238 enum nvme_ctrl_state {
239 	NVME_CTRL_NEW,
240 	NVME_CTRL_LIVE,
241 	NVME_CTRL_RESETTING,
242 	NVME_CTRL_CONNECTING,
243 	NVME_CTRL_DELETING,
244 	NVME_CTRL_DELETING_NOIO,
245 	NVME_CTRL_DEAD,
246 };

557 /*
558  * nvme command_id is constructed as such:
559  * | xxxx | xxxxxxxxxxxx |
560  *   gen    request tag
561  */
562 #define nvme_genctr_mask(gen)			(gen & 0xf)
563 #define nvme_cid_install_genctr(gen)		(nvme_genctr_mask(gen) << 12)
564 #define nvme_genctr_from_cid(cid)		((cid & 0xf000) >> 12)
565 #define nvme_tag_from_cid(cid)			(cid & 0xfff)
566 
nvme_cid(struct request * rq)567 static inline u16 nvme_cid(struct request *rq)
568 {
569 	return nvme_cid_install_genctr(nvme_req(rq)->genctr) | rq->tag;
570 }
571 
nvme_find_rq(struct blk_mq_tags * tags,u16 command_id)572 static inline struct request *nvme_find_rq(struct blk_mq_tags *tags,
573 		u16 command_id)
574 {
575 	u8 genctr = nvme_genctr_from_cid(command_id);
576 	u16 tag = nvme_tag_from_cid(command_id);
577 	struct request *rq;
578 
579 	rq = blk_mq_tag_to_rq(tags, tag);
580 	if (unlikely(!rq)) {
581 		pr_err("could not locate request for tag %#x\n",
582 			tag);
583 		return NULL;
584 	}
585 	if (unlikely(nvme_genctr_mask(nvme_req(rq)->genctr) != genctr)) {
586 		dev_err(nvme_req(rq)->ctrl->device,
587 			"request %#x genctr mismatch (got %#x expected %#x)\n",
588 			tag, genctr, nvme_genctr_mask(nvme_req(rq)->genctr));
589 		return NULL;
590 	}
591 	return rq;
592 }
593 
nvme_cid_to_rq(struct blk_mq_tags * tags,u16 command_id)594 static inline struct request *nvme_cid_to_rq(struct blk_mq_tags *tags,
595                 u16 command_id)
596 {
597 	return blk_mq_tag_to_rq(tags, nvme_tag_from_cid(command_id));
598 }
